And finally… Carr-boot
Hundreds of unwanted treasures from the Scottish castle bought by comedian Alan Carr are heading to auction.
More than 400 items left behind by the previous owner of Ayton Castle in the Scottish Borders – including Victorian furniture, artwork, rugs and ceramics – will go under the hammer before Carr moves in.
Among the standout lots is a Bentley expected to fetch between £20,000 and £30,000, STV News reports.
Carr’s new life restoring the historic castle will also feature in an upcoming Disney+ series.
